S. Guitton is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Infectious Diseases and General Health Professions. According to data from OpenAlex, S. Guitton has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 300 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Epidemiology, 5 papers in Infectious Diseases and 1 paper in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in S. Guitton's work include Cytomegalovirus and herpesvirus research (4 papers), Parvovirus B19 Infection Studies (4 papers) and Herpesvirus Infections and Treatments (3 papers). S. Guitton is often cited by papers focused on Cytomegalovirus and herpesvirus research (4 papers), Parvovirus B19 Infection Studies (4 papers) and Herpesvirus Infections and Treatments (3 papers). S. Guitton collaborates with scholars based in France. S. Guitton's co-authors include Christelle Vauloup‐Fellous, Alexandra Benachi, Olivier Picone, Anne‐Gaël Cordier, F. Fuchs, Marie‐Victoire Sénat, L. Grangeot‐Keros, A. Cordier, Laurent Mandelbrot and Jeanne Sibiude and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Virology, Prenatal Diagnosis and Annales Pharmaceutiques Françaises.
